If your FocalPoint website is hosted by Access the URL will probably contain the string accessacloud.com.
​
If your FocalPoint website is not hosted by Access it can be configured either to use a user name & password to authenticate a user ,or the users windows login .
​
If you have problems logging into a non-hosted FocalPoint website , that uses the user windows login to authenticate the user., then try resetting the window password..
​
If you still have problems check that a FocalPoint user has been created for you

  1. Log into FocalPoint administrator

  2. Go to menu options System Control ,Security Profile

  3. Select any profile

  4. Click on Members

  5. If your login name does not exist in the right hand or left hand window, then follow the steps in t he Knowledge base article: FocalPoint: How to Create a User Record.

  6. If user exists in the right window but does not have a profile listed against the login. This mean you have a Dimensions user but not a FocalPoint user. then follow steps in the knowledge base article FocalPoint : I Get The Error "A User with User Id X already exists." or "A User with User Name X already exists" When Creating A User With The User Creation Wizard.

If your FocalPoint website uses a name & password to authenticate a user, and you FocalPoint website is not hosted by access., There are two ways to reset a users password :

  1. If the user still knows their current password they can log into FocalPoint, click on their name in the top right and select Change Password

  2. If the user does not know their current password, then this will need to be changed by an administrator in the FocalPoint Administrator.

To change the password in FocalPoint Administrator:

  1. Log into FocalPoint Administrator - making sure you are connecting to the right database

  2. Navigate to System Control, Security Profiles

  3. Highlight the relevant profile and click Members

  4. Highlight the relevant user in the list on the left

  5. Click on the Details tab and enter a new password in the New .Net Password field
